About the book – Book 1

At 26, Axel's life had been turned upside down. His grandfather and only living family member beyond all reason, had just been brutally murdered. Axle had walked in on a sight that would haunt him for the rest of his days.

Two years prior, the love of his life, fiancée Sarah, had mysteriously disappeared the night before their wedding. Her blood had been found alongside the road leading from town.

He'd never known his mother, who died that fateful night when he was born, of suspicious circumstances, to which his grandfather refused to speak of.

With this gaping hole in his now empty, fragile heart, and being a prime suspect for two crimes in such a short space of time, would Axle be able to unravel any possible clues to his grandfather's violent demise and prove his own innocence?

    Chapter 1

    AXEL STOOD STARING into the freshly dug grave, where his grandfather had just been lowered into. As the well-wishers started to drift away from the area, he continued to stare deep in contemplation at the site. He was used to death by this point, having lived his entire life in the shadows of that inevitable fate. His mother died the night he was born, and the circumstances were such that his grandfather refused to speak of it. At twenty-six, Axel simply knew that the night he entered the world, she exited. She took her father’s heart with her that night, and the shell of a man that was left, always had sadness visible in his eyes.
